Join our kitchen team to showcase your creativity, grow your skills and help deliver outstanding dining experiences for our guests.
Other businesses may call this role Commis Chef, Chef de Partie, Prep Cook or Line Cook.
This role reports to the Kitchen Manager.
What you'll do:
- Cook and present dishes to recipe standards, ensuring quality and consistency.
- Support the creation of daily specials to showcase your skills and excite our guests.
- Keep food prep areas stocked, clean, and ready throughout service.
- Follow food safety standards and help minimise waste.
- Work with your team and Kitchen Manager to deliver excellent guest experiences.
What we’re looking for
- Previous cooking experience (restaurant, hotel, pub or similar) or a willingness to learn by joining our Chef Academy and completing a funded Level 2 Commis Chef qualification.
- Knowledge of cooking methods, ingredients, and kitchen equipment.
- Basic Food Safety certification (or willingness to complete training).
- A passion for great food and creating memorable guest experiences.
- A positive attitude, commitment to teamwork and desire to learn.
